Alekos Alexiadis was a star forward for Aris during the period 1963 - 1975.

Alexiadis was born in 1945. He is second, behind Dinos Kouis, on the all-time scorers list for Aris, having found the mark 127 times in his 301 appearances for the club.

In 1976, Alexiadis played for Panaitolikos FC and the following year for Kastoria FC.

Overall, Alexiadis has an impressive 329 appearances in the Alpha Ethniki. He was capped twice by the Greek National Football Team, scoring 2 goals.
